For centuries, the people of Valisthea have relied on the land’s Mothercrystals as a source of magicks that aid their daily lives. But as a cursed disease known as the Blight starts to spread, a group of rebels dares to ask… what if the Mothercrystals are to blame? Join Clive and his companions as they fight to free the world of its doomed fate.
Pros
Great Story and Characters
FFXVI delivers a top-tier story with unforgettable characters. This world is brutally raw with fascinating political and social structures. Similar to Game of Thrones and Jemisin’s Broken Earth trilogy, Valisthea is complex, unforgiving, and unfair. It serves as a perfect basis to instantly hook you to the story.
Along with a gripping story, the main characters are extremely well developed. I instantly fell in love with Clive and Cid. Their relationship development (and banter) was a true joy to be a part of. Dion, Uncle Byron, and Gav were also some of my favorites to interact with. Each brought a unique personality and background that tremendously added to the storyline.
Unquestionably Epic
From start to finish, FFXVI was unrelentingly epic. The Eikon and Dominant battles, the cinematic showdowns, the intensely emotional ending… this game delivered an experience that is difficult to adequately put to words.
Cons
Gameplay Mechanics
Let’s consider the combat. It is truly real-time. There’s no slow-down or pause option to choose a special ability. At first it’s manageable. But as you gather more special abilities, it is hard to keep up with their availability while also dodging and managing Torgal’s commands. It can quickly devolve into button mashing. Alongside the combat mechanics, the camera isn’t exactly your friend. Some battles were so chaotic that I didn’t know where I was, where the enemy was, and if I was hitting them or not…
Exploration
The open world moments are meager. The game relies heavily on fast travel and when you do get the option to have a more open world experience, it is limited. You see a set of stairs that you can’t climb. A set of crates that you can’t jump onto. A building that you can’t enter.
Things to Consider
Easy Mode
The developers took a different approach for adjusting the difficulty level of the game. Instead of choosing easy, normal, or hard, you get a set of rings that you can choose to equip that can make the game’s combat easier. I used the Ring of Timely Focus and Ring of Timely Assistance. But you only have three slots for accessories and by using these rings, you limit your options in the game to equip other accessories that boost your abilities.
Cinematics
FFXVI could have benefitted from the fast forward feature that we had in FFVII. The cinematic scenes are long and there are plenty of them. At times, it felt more like a movie than a video game.
Final Fantasy Feel
This game may not feel like a tried and true Final Fantasy game. There are no side games. There are very few lighter, fun moments to break up the intense storyline. It is notably more violent, serious, and mature than other Final Fantasy games that I’ve played. Was that a bad thing? No, I don’t think so. But it is something to have in mind – don’t come into this expecting a traditional Final Fantasy experience.
Overall…
Final Fantasy XVI boldly goes where no Final Fantasy game has gone before. Once I got used to the look and feel of FFXVI, I absolutely fell in love. The more mature, older characters, the flawed and epic world, and the unique approach to magic made the game an unforgettable experience. It is a bold and phenomenal addition to the Final Fantasy series.
